    If you enabled persistent storage in Tails then that is why the USB drive shows up as raw since the USB drive is encrypted.

    Can the drive boot Tails?

    If you're wanting to just format the drive, then you may need to go into Computer Management | Storage | Disk Management. Now right click the USB drive and format. If that doesn't work then a program called DiskGenius may work to format the drive.

    An easy way to get to Computer Management in Windows 7 is to right click the My Computer icon (if on your desktop) and chose the option from the right click context menu. Or simply enter Computer Management in Windows search. It's also found in the Windows Control Panel.
